Output 5c4126c0b71286763963ba9553984fcd74a6936fb86b5722cacfba837b8cc085:1

value
169089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f159fa17e639f51a3323aed30248633c134fef3 OP_EQUAL
address
3K7NtcbTrZXJTydZAuahNUvz2EjoSxUffP
transaction
5c4126c0b71286763963ba9553984fcd74a6936fb86b5722cacfba837b8cc085
confirmations
467665
spent
true